Trail Tips

Carry Plenty of Water and Snacks

Ensure you stay hydrated and energized during your long rides by bringing enough water and snacks for each day.

Check the Bike for Comfort and Fit

Adjust your bike’s seat and handlebars before starting to prevent discomfort during extended riding sessions.

Plan Rest Stops Ahead

Map out local beaches, parks, or cafes to take breaks and soak in the views.

Mind the Coastal Winds

Be prepared for occasional breezes that can impact your riding effort, especially along open beachfront stretches.

History

Little Compton has a rich maritime history, with many old wharves and historic farms dating back to the 17th century.

Conservation

The area emphasizes preserving its coastal ecosystems, with local efforts to protect native wildlife and maintain trail sustainability.
